About This Item

Coward-McCann, 1961. 1st Edition. Hardcover. Fine/Fine. Green cloth boards under white dust jacket, 8.25" x 5.5", 93 pp. A lovely copy. Published the year before the Tony Award-winning "Who's Afraid of Virginia Woolf" which, although he was well-known from the get-go, would rocket him to fame, especially after the film.
